The Western Conference final between the Detroit Red Wings and Dallas Stars hit the fan Saturday night when Chris Osgood butt-ended Mike Ribeiro, who responded with a wicked two-hander across the chest. Neither man will be suspended for Monday night’s Game 3. Detroit goes into Big D as a road favorite with a 2-0 series lead, outscoring the Stars 6-2.

The Eastern Conference is unfolding in similar fashion. The Pittsburgh Penguins won the first two games of their series against the Philadelphia Flyers, both games ending 4-2. The Flyers are already missing defenseman Kimmo Timonen, and they lost another blueliner Sunday when Braydon Coburn was hit in the face with a puck at the start of Game 2. Coburn’s status for Tuesday’s Game 3 was unknown at press time. The Flyers have won nine of their last 10 games at home; the last nine times they’ve faced the Penguins, the home team won.
